PostHeaderIcon PussyCat Dolls Dance Team

Started in 1995, the Pussy Cat Dolls are a pop group from the United States. They did not start out as a pop group, however; they started as a burlesque group and then became a musical group. The musical group began in 2003 before they began Reality T.V. Programs and other activities including a Los Vegas Act. Their debut album, "PCD," debuted at number five on the charts. Their song, "Don't Cha" became a number one single on the charts. Their second album was released in September 2008 and is growing in popularity.

Some famous names that were a part of the burlesque group called the Pussycat Dolls are: Carmen Electra, Carmit Bachar, Cyia Batten, Staci Flood, Christina Applegate, Christina Aguilera, Gwen Stafani and Kim Kardashian. As part of the recording group there were Carmit Bachar, Cyia Batten, Kasey Campbell, Kaya Jones and Asia Nitollano. It all began when Anton invited some girlfriends over and they began playing around with some choreography in Anton’s garage. Gwen Stefani came to one of their shows and decided that she would do a guest spot. This gave them more notoriety and their careers took off as the Pussycat Dolls.

Carmit Bachar was a member of the Pussycat Dolls for the longest amount of time. She was born on September 4 1974, and was a main vocalist of the Pussycat Dolls. She is very involved in an organization that helps people who were born with a facial deformity. She was actually born with a cleft palate, and instructs people on the importance of inner beauty versus outer beauty. Her project, "Operation Smile" had a medical mission over in Bolivia to help children there.

The Pussycat Dolls started as a dance team, and continued on to be successful as a musical group. They worked well together, and it was obvious the amount of care they felt towards each other as it was reflected in both their dance and music. Carmit was the member that remained with them the longest and made a name for herself through her performances. She has since gone on to work with Macy Grey, and she is expected to release a new album in the near future. All of the Pussycat Dolls have found fame in one degree or another, and have been a force in the music and dance industry. Together, they have made the word "burlesque" a household word again.
